It is with great sadness that the family of John "Johnny" R. Mathews announces his passing at AngelsGrace Hospice after a long illness.
Johnny was born December 18, 1959 and died December 9, 2018 at the age of 58. He grew up in Brookfield WI. He was a professional chef and longtime Merchant Mariner working at sea all over the world. He will be remembered as a sensitive, humble and compassionate man with a great sense of humor.
Johnny is survived by his longtime partner Sheri Storlie, brother Edwin (Tracie) Mathews Jr., sister Stephanie (Jeff) Seitz, daughter Megan (Mathew) LaCombe and granddaughter Evelyn, step-sisters Sarah (nee Sullivan) Doyle, and Judy (nee Ebertsch) Blake and cousins Linda and Michelle Lauby. He is further survived by his aunt Yvonne (nee Patsky) Shortess, n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ends.
Johnny is predeceased by his parents Edwin and Virjean (nee Lauby) Mathews, step-mother Judy (nee Sullivan) Mathews and step-father Martin Ebertsch.
Private family services to be held at Wisconsin Memorial Park.
Those who so desire may make Memorial Donations in memory of Johnny to the Waukesha County Technical College's Culinary Arts Scholarship Program or to AngelsGrace Hospice.
